Increasing Demand for Population Health Analytics

On a population-wide scale, employing big data analytics to improve healthcare can significantly save costs by identifying the people who are at higher risk for disease and arranging early treatments before the situation worsens. Big data is used in healthcare by aggregating data on a variety of parameters such as medical history, lab values, medications, comorbidities, and socioeconomic profile. Policymakers have started to use data for decision-making as more data becomes available. Data related to hospital readmission rates is used to establish policies targeted at reducing needless readmissions. Patient satisfaction data is now being utilised to impact policies ranging from provider reimbursement to hospital transparency. For instance, in April 2023, Amitech Solutions, a healthcare data, analytics and automation consulting company, released Healthcare Pricing Analytics Solution, a first-of-its-kind, on Snowflake's Marketplace. It is based on publicly available hospital and payer pricing data, but they go beyond the raw data to provide insights that support collaboration among all healthcare stakeholders to reduce costs of treatment.

Extensive Implementation in Cancer Research

According to World Health Organization, approximately 14 million people suffer from cancer every year. In the next 20 years, the number is predicted to increase by almost 70%. Oncologists are using data to deliver individualised treatments based on biopsy specimens, patient histories, and other relevant data. Numerous types of cancer-related data from patient case histories, international research, and surveys are being compiled by institutions all over the world. Researchers are utilising Natural Language Processing (NLP) systems to analyse through millions of health records in a population to determine patterns, trends, and patient similarity metrics. For instance, in October 2022, Tempus, a pioneer in AI and precision medicine, has introduced Tempus+, a proprietary platform that uses real-world data to drive collaborative precision oncology research.

Government Initiative

Several local governments have introduced various initiatives for the upliftment of big data in healthcare industry. For instance, the Data Integration Partnership for Australia (DIPA) is a three-year, USD130.8 million project, aimed to maximize the use and value of the government's data assets. DIPA used data integration and analysis to provide fresh insights into crucial and challenging policy issues. Over 20 Commonwealth agencies worked together as a whole-of-government initiative to advance technical data infrastructure and data integration capabilities throughout the Australian Public Service. Important data assets, such as those in the social welfare, health, and education sectors, were upgraded, enabling policymakers to get insights that were previously not possible. Because DIPA only allowed access to regulated, de-identified, and confidential data for policy analysis and research purposes, individual privacy and the security of sensitive data is preserved. Likewise, governments across the globe are encouraging use of big data analytics to enhance healthcare infrastructure and promote well-structured healthcare landscape.

Growing Application of Big Data Analytics in Pharmaceutical Research

 

The development of a new medicine is a highly costly endeavor as it requires extensive pharmaceutical research. As per Congressional Budget Office (CBO), the cost of medicine development can range from USD 1 billion to USD 2 billion, encompassing capital expenditures and investments in unsuccessful drug candidates. However, big data analytics offers a powerful solution by enabling intelligent searches across extensive databases comprising patents, academic articles, and clinical trial data. This technology empowers researchers to efficiently navigate these vast datasets, accelerating the process of generating new medications. In the pharmaceutical sector, big data analytics have already been leveraged to streamline online searches for immense datasets encompassing existing and pending patents, as well as publications from relevant academic journals. This capability enables researchers to access and analyze valuable information swiftly, enhancing their knowledge base and facilitating the discovery of novel therapeutic compounds.

Moreover, big data analytics plays a crucial role in the pharmaceutical industry's pre-commercialization phase. By harnessing these analytics, companies can identify the optimal patient demographics for clinical trials, ensuring a diverse and representative participant pool. Remote monitoring and analysis of previous clinical trial data can also be facilitated, allowing for comprehensive evaluation of drug safety and efficacy. This technology aids in the early detection and reporting of potential side effects, enabling pharmaceutical companies to address any concerns proactively.

Hence, big data analytics in healthcare present significant opportunities for the pharmaceutical industry to streamline drug development processes, improve research efficiency, and enhance patient safety. By harnessing the power of vast datasets and advanced analytical techniques, the industry can drive innovation, optimize decision-making, and ultimately bring safer and more effective medications to the market.

Impact of COVID-19


The utilization of big data analytics has emerged as a pivotal factor in healthcare decision-making, particularly in the context of the COVID-19 pandemic. The ongoing global health crisis has witnessed an exponential surge in the volume and variety of health data being collected and modified, thereby facilitating more extensive and sophisticated analytics. This has, in turn, led to a deeper comprehension of effective response strategies and treatment modalities for patients. Significantly, the COVID-19 pandemic has underscored the existing challenges associated with health data exchange between organizations and the notable lack of standardization in data collection and analysis methodologies. These obstacles have further highlighted the criticality of implementing robust data governance frameworks and standardized protocols to enhance data sharing and promote interoperability within the healthcare ecosystem. In the aftermath of the pandemic, the healthcare industry has recognized the operational advantages of leveraging big data analytics to drive informed decision-making processes. Industry players are increasingly forging strategic partnerships aimed at developing advanced data analytics platforms tailored specifically for the healthcare sector.
